Just for orientation purposes, we drove to Taft Point and hiked from there to Sentinel Dome and on to Glacier Point. It's a short route, less than 10km, but it showcases the most spectacular and popular points of the park: El Capitan, Upper and Lower Yosemite Falls, the Valley and Half Dome.
